WHY MEETING YOUR PARTNERS SEXUAL NEEDS CAN HAVE EMOTIONAL CONSEQUENCES

Sexual compatibility between partners is important for maintaining a healthy relationship.

When one partner's sexual needs are consistently prioritized above their own, it can have significant emotional consequences. Here are some potential outcomes that may arise:

1. Loss of self-esteem - If a person constantly feels like they are not meeting their partner's sexual needs, they may begin to question their worthiness as a lover. This can lead to feelings of shame, guilt, and low self-worth.

2. Resentment - When one partner is always giving and the other is always taking, resentment can build up over time. This can cause tension and distance in the relationship.

3. Feelings of isolation - If a person's sexual desires are ignored or denied, they may feel isolated and alone within the relationship. They may withdraw from intimacy altogether or seek satisfaction elsewhere.

4. Frustration - Consistently prioritizing someone else's sexual needs can create frustration and resentment. The partner who feels unfulfilled may become angry, which can damage trust and communication in the relationship.

5. Unmet expectations - It's essential to communicate openly about sexual preferences and boundaries. If a partner's needs are not met, it can lead to disappointment, anger, and resentment.

6. Pressure - Feeling pressured into having sex can be emotionally damaging. Partners may feel forced into situations they don't want to be in, leading to negative associations with sex and intimacy.

7. Difficulty in resolving conflict - When partners consistently prioritize each other's sexual needs, they may avoid talking about difficult topics that could impact their relationship. This can lead to problems down the road.

8. Lack of balance - A healthy relationship requires balance between partners. When one partner consistently gives while the other takes, the balance shifts, creating an imbalance in the relationship.

It's important for both partners to communicate openly about their sexual needs and desires. This way, they can find a balance that works for them, ensuring both parties' needs are met.

What emotional consequences arise from consistently prioritizing a partner's sexual needs over one's own?

The emotional consequences of consistently prioritizing a partner's sexual needs over one's own can be varied and complex. One common consequence is that an individual may experience feelings of resentment, frustration, and even guilt due to sacrificing their own desires for the sake of pleasing their partner. This can lead to decreased self-esteem, increased stress levels, and potentially strain on the relationship if it becomes a long-term pattern.
